About The Team

Stripe is looking for an outstanding transactional lawyer to join our commercial legal team supporting our fast-growing business in EMEA. We are committed to building an inclusive work environment where all Stripes feel welcomed as their authentic selves—inclusive of all genders, sexual orientations, ethnicities, races, education, ages, and other personal characteristics. We work on broadening our internal diversity because we want to be culturally equipped to build products and solutions for our diverse user base.

What you'll do

As a core member of our Commercial Legal team, you'll have the opportunity to build strategic relationships with regional sales leaders. You'll act as a force multiplier, directly influencing the growth of Stripe's business in EMEA. We trust you to exercise independent judgement and encourage you to bring forward ideas for scaling and streamlining our contracting process. You'll have the opportunity to develop your legal knowledge and technical skills working at the frontier of payments and fintech innovation.

Responsibilities
  • Support the EMEA sales team, leading negotiations and advising on a wide range of commercial and legal issues
  • Be an integral part of the build out of Stripe's commercial legal infrastructure so that we can scale and operate efficiently at pace with Stripe's exponential growth—this work includes drafting and maintaining Stripe's agreements and playbooks, leading and contributing to projects to improve internal processes and operational efficiencies
  • Work with teams across Stripe, including sales, privacy, operations, product, tax, and risk groups
  • Develop and deliver training and other resources to help the Sales team sell our products
  • Be a point of escalation for outside counsel
Who you are

We're looking for someone who meets the minimum requirements to be considered for the role. If you meet these requirements, you are encouraged to apply. The preferred qualifications are a bonus, not a requirement.

Minimum Requirements
  • 7+ years of relevant experience as a lawyer in-house or in a technology practice group in a top law firm
  • Intellectually curious and a creative problem solver—Stripe's products and our industry are complex and ever evolving—you relish learning new things and finding creative solutions to challenging problems
  • A self-starter with a bias for action—you're proactive and have a strong sense of ownership
  • A clear and concise communicator (in written and verbal forms), who distills the key risks and explains complex, nuanced issues in plain and simple terms
  • A natural collaborator, able to guide cross-functional teams and drive to a win-win solution
  • Familiar with the range of legal issues and commercial risks that arise in connection with hosted data and technology services
  • A team player who is willing to do what it takes to contribute to the collective success
  • High professional fluency in French and English
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ience working in payment or fintech industries and knowledge of associated regulatory issues
  • In-house experience advising high-growth technology companies
  • A working knowledge of relevant data protection and AI regulations
In-office expectations

Office-assigned Stripes in most of our locations are currently expected to spend at least 50% of the time in a given month in their local office or with users. This expectation may vary depending on role, team and location. For example, Stripes in Stripe Delivery Center roles in Mexico City, Mexico, Bengaluru, India, and Dublin, Ireland work 100% from the office. Also, some teams have greater in-office attendance requirements, to appropriately support our users and workflows, which the hiring manager will discuss. This approach helps strike a balance between bringing people together for in-person collaboration and learning from each other, while supporting flexibility when possible.
